Output 389bc7a5076d89d2a05c8e51762aea2ce2f6340247a1f6b9ee40d1cb03c8fbae: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56ba10614d94fb426214aa5d8ee86555e49b61d OP_EQUAL
address
MUpDuZ3awwMinRAdkmpjFC3QiGxo5sGLwZ
transaction
389bc7a5076d89d2a05c8e51762aea2ce2f6340247a1f6b9ee40d1cb03c8fbae
spent
true